Sumner and Ottens both referred to the tribunal. I'm expecting Ottens charge to be thrown out due to concussion from the Sumner hit.

Adelaide defender Andy Otten will front the SANFL Tribunal on Wednesday night after being charged with intentionally making contact with an umpire.
Otten made contact with field umpire Leigh Haussen during the fourth quarter of the match between Adelaide and Glenelg at Gliderol Stadium on Sunday. The AFL-listed backman’s case has been referred directly to the Tribunal by the SANFL’s Incident Review Panel, in accordance with the SANFL Tribunal guidelines.

GLENELG forward Tim Sumner will also face the SANFL Tribunal on Wednesday evening after being charged with striking Otten on Sunday at Gliderol Stadium. Sumner’s case has been referred directly to the SANFL Tribunal after the Incident Review Panel deemed he made intentional, high contact to Otten which was of high impact. A medical report noted Otten had concussion and was removed from the game shortly after the incident.
